WebMay 7, 2024 · Listed below are several elements that, according to Ramos, contribute to our nation’s cultural identity. Palengke or market. This is a public space that functions as a cultural hub where food is prepared, sold, weighed, or purchased. Carinderia. A local eatery or food stall that is popular for ‘lutong-bahay’ or home-cooked meals. WebTaho. A mágtatahô walking through a residential area in Manila. Tahô ( Tagalog: [tɐˈhoʔ]) is a Philippine snack food made of fresh soft/silken tofu, arnibal (sweetener and flavoring), and sago pearl (similar to tapioca pearls ). [2] This staple comfort food is a signature sweet and tahô peddlers can be found all over the country.
